>> I watched the presentation again. Yes, Rob said the K3 was fixed in 2008.
>> He also said the fix wasn't as good as he'd like. It didn't compete with
>> the <0.3% distortion of the Icom 756 Pro III. So if you look at the
>> distortion products at 44:20, would the average amateur (like me) be able
>> to hear that?
> Short answer: No.
>
> I have excellent hearing (I'm an acoustic guitarist and pianist in my
> "spare time"), and after we made all the updates to the K3, I burned quite
> a bit of lab time trying to hear what Rob was talking about. I tried
> *really* hard, as did my staff. We couldn't hear it. Rob is superhuman :)
>
> True, it would be possible to reclaim a bit of extra AF headroom by using
> an AF amp that's heavily biased (class A). But 99% of operators would not
> benefit, the radio would draw an extra 200-300 mA with no signal in
> receive mode, and the chip(s) would need fairly extensive heat sinking.
> Doesn't seem like a good tradeoff.
>
> (Disclaimer: I'm biased towards energy efficiency and portability.)
